K Grasedyck is a scholar working on Rheumatology, Molecular Biology and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, K Grasedyck has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 380 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Rheumatology, 4 papers in Molecular Biology and 3 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in K Grasedyck's work include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(2 papers), Spondyloarthritis Studies and Treatments (2 papers) and Connective tissue disorders research (2 papers). K Grasedyck is often cited by papers focused on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(2 papers), Spondyloarthritis Studies and Treatments (2 papers) and Connective tissue disorders research (2 papers). K Grasedyck coll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and Austria. K Grasedyck's co-authors include B. Bromm, J. Lorenz, M Schattenkirchner, Joseph M. Braun, Eleanor J. Beck, Michael R. Baumgaertner, H. Zeidler, Hildrun Haibel, Josef Hermann and J. Brandt and has published in prestigious journals such as Annals of the Rheumatic Diseases, Advances in experimental medicine and biology and Journal of Molecular Medicine.
